Streamlining AI Chatbot Customer Service with KIBO AI
KIBO Commerce, a prominent provider in composable commerce and order management solutions, has unveiled KIBO AI, its latest evolution in agentic offerings. This redesigned Agentic Layer integrates all AI-driven interactions across commerce and order management into a cohesive, single experience. For a Customer Support Professional, this means engaging with one intelligent agent through a unified interface, while a sophisticated network of specialized agents works behind the scenes to manage diverse tasks.
This development marks a substantial advancement from KIBO’s prior agentic commerce solution, which utilized nine distinct agents. KIBO AI now centralizes these capabilities within a framework built on three core principles: a singular data model encompassing both commerce and order management systems (OMS), a ‘Bring Your Own Model’ (BYOM) strategy to avoid LLM vendor lock-in, and KIBO’s proprietary Agentic Framework, now fully operational across all five primary functions.
How KIBO AI Transforms the Customer Support Professional’s Workflow
The new KIBO AI system presents a single agent as the primary point of contact for various roles, including shoppers, merchandisers, fulfillment teams, supply chain managers, and critically, Customer Support Professionals. This unified front-end simplifies how support teams access and utilize AI capabilities. Behind this intuitive interface, KIBO’s Agentic Framework intelligently directs tasks to specialized agents based on the user’s role, the context of their query, and the specific task at hand. This dynamic routing occurs seamlessly, eliminating the need for the Customer Support Professional to understand the underlying complexity of which agent is handling which part of their request.
Eric Rosado, Chief Product Officer at KIBO Commerce, emphasized the strategic design: “We made a deliberate choice: one agentic experience for your team to work with, one data model connecting commerce and OMS, and the freedom to choose any AI model you trust. This is the next iteration of our agentic evolution—a platform built to augment our client’s execution teams.” This approach ensures that a Customer Support Professional can focus on customer resolution rather than navigating disparate AI tools.
The Power of a Unified Data Model for Support Automation AI
A key differentiator of KIBO AI is its foundation on a single, unified data model that spans both commerce and order management. This architecture ensures that every interaction within KIBO AI is grounded in the same consistent, real-time data. For a Customer Support Professional, this means instant access to accurate, up-to-date information regarding customer orders, inventory, promotions, and more, without needing to cross-reference multiple systems. This consistency is crucial for effective support automation AI and for providing definitive answers to customer inquiries.

Practical Applications for Customer Support Professionals
The five core functions of KIBO AI offer direct benefits for Customer Support Professionals:
- Configure: This function allows operators to set up and modify platform settings and rules using natural language. For instance, a support agent could quickly verify a promotion’s details, like a ‘15% off for loyalty members on all footwear, valid this weekend only,’ directly impacting how they handle customer discount queries.
- Explain: This capability answers complex operational data questions in plain language, eliminating the need for SQL knowledge or extensive report digging. A Customer Support Professional can ask, ‘Why did this order get routed to a store instead of the nearest DC?’ or ‘Why is the stackable discount not combining correctly at checkout?’ and receive clear, contextual interpretations grounded in live commerce and OMS data. This drastically reduces investigation time and improves first-contact resolution rates.
- Analyze: Delivering advanced, AI-driven reporting across the entire commerce and order management data model, the Analyze function surfaces trends, anomalies, and cross-functional insights in real-time. While primarily for operational teams, a Customer Support Professional could leverage this to understand broader patterns affecting customer experience, such as ‘Show the on-time shipment rate by node, carrier, and region for the last 30 days,’ helping them manage customer expectations or identify systemic issues.
